If you have a complaint against a market participant (a Dealing Company or Broker or a listed company) please register your complaint directly with the market participant concerned. At the first instance, CMDA expects the investor to resolve the complaint with the market participant.


Investors who are dissatisfied with the manner in which the complaint was handled by the market participant or the reply from the market participant, they should lodge a complaint in writing directly to the CMDA.

 

Where a complaint is received by CMDA, the procedures for handling the complaint is as follows:

  1. The CMDA will write to the market participant concerned and clarify any issues that it may have. After that CMDA will decide on what course(s) of action to take.
  2. Where the CMDA is not satisfied with the reply from the market participant then the CMDA may conduct an investigation and take appropriate actions against the market participant.
  3. The complainant shall be informed of the decision taken by the CMDA.
The CMDA has wide powers under the Securities Act (2006) to investigate breaches of the Maldives Securities Act, Regulations and Rules.
